Nordic Porcelain Tea Bowls with Celadon Glaze for Steady Heat Retention

Nordic porcelain tea bowl in soft blue with celadon glaze, 10cm diameter holds 300ml for steady tea warmth

These Nordic-style porcelain tea bowls come in solid colours like medium grey, soft blue, and muted pink, each designed for the simple act of drinking tea. The 10cm diameter version accommodates 300ml, allowing space for loose-leaf varieties that swell without overflow. Porcelain's thermal properties mean the walls stay warm to the touch but distribute heat evenly, preventing burns during handling. The celadon surface technology adds a layer of subtle translucency, mimicking traditional East Asian glazes while fitting modern British kitchens. At 200g, the largest size feels substantial yet light enough for daily reach. Stackability saves space in compact cupboards, fitting multiple units into minimal area. This makes them practical for solo tea drinkers or small gatherings, where quick access matters.

Technical Specifications

Porcelain firing reaches 1280°C, achieving a vitrified structure with zero water absorption, which translates to no flavour retention between brews—ideal for switching from black to herbal teas. Capacities are exact: 4.5cm bowls hold 150ml at a fill line marked subtly by the glaze transition; 7.5cm offers 220ml; 8cm provides 250ml; and 10cm manages 300ml without tipping risks due to low centre of gravity. Microwave exposure up to 800W reheats contents in 45 seconds evenly, thanks to 0.5cm wall thickness. Thermal shock resistance handles pours from kettles at 100°C directly, with no cracking reported in tests up to 50 cycles. Weight scales from 120g for smallest to 200g for largest, ensuring stability on uneven surfaces like garden tables. Celadon glaze thickness measures 0.2mm, providing barrier against acids in teas scoring pH below 4.

Build Quality Details

Each bowl undergoes double-firing: bisque at 1000°C followed by glaze at 1280°C, resulting in a chip-resistant rim reinforced along the 1mm edge. Porcelain's kaolin-clay base, comprising 50% kaolin and 30% feldspar, yields compressive strength over 500kg/cm², far exceeding everyday drop tests from waist height. The solid colour pigments, iron-based for grey and blue, bond permanently, showing no fade after 100 dishwasher runs at 50°C. Celadon glaze, derived from ash and iron oxide, forms a crackle pattern under 0.1mm that self-seals minor scratches, extending surface life. Hand-finishing removes any kiln spurs, leaving a seamless interior. This construction supports 10-year use in moderate households, with replacement rates under 5% for normal wear.
